Buying Guide: Key Considerations For Folding Shutters

  • Material and finish: Interior options often use poly resin for durability and easy cleaning, while exterior styles favor weather-resistant plastics or wood for aesthetic warmth. Finishes should coordinate with room decor and be resistant to fading or warping in sunlight.
  • Installation method: DIY-friendly models can save on labor, but ensure measurements account for frame depth, headroom, and tilt rod presence. Custom-made units typically offer a precise fit but require lead times.
  • Slat design and tilt mechanism: No-front-tilt rods create a modern, streamlined look and easier cleaning, while traditional tilt rods offer a classic feel. Hidden gears may improve appearance but consider ease of operation and maintenance access.
  • Durability and maintenance: Poly resin and UV-protected polymers are common for exterior use, reducing maintenance needs. Wood shutters require moisture control but provide a warm, natural aesthetic.
  • Size and compatibility: Exterior shutters often come in standard sizes but may require trimming or custom sizing for unusual window dimensions. Check tolerance ranges and installation hardware compatibility.
  • Color and curb appeal: Exterior options can dramatically affect home value and style. Choose colors that complement architectural features and surrounding landscape.
  • Warranty and support: Look for manufacturers offering warranties and clear installation guidance. A robust warranty helps cover cracking, fading, or hardware failure over time.
  • Environmental considerations: For outdoor use, select weatherproof materials and corrosion-resistant hardware. For interior spaces, consider low-emission finishes if indoor air quality is a concern.
